Output c23929a83e651b89d0b71aa73719b82b08087bd65d9c2336b1f45ca94e937e3a:0

value
42435927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594c882a6bc42b7e84d7c4481d73a73b942f6053 OP_EQUAL
address
MG3L42qixDSQiivGjih3NnB7deaS7mbwke
transaction
c23929a83e651b89d0b71aa73719b82b08087bd65d9c2336b1f45ca94e937e3a
spent
true